A very thin plate of metal is placed exactly in the middle of the two plates of a parallel plate capacitor. What will be the effect on the capacitance of the system?

Text Solution

Verified by Experts

For a metal `K=oo` and so when `t lt lt d`, the capacitance,
`C=(epsi_(0)A)/(d-t(1-(1)/(K)))=(epsi_(0)A)/(d-t(1-(1)/(oo)))=(epsi_(0)A)/(d-t),` As `t lt lt d, C=(epsi_(0)A)/(d)`
i.e., capacitance will remain unchanged.
